AI Summary

  • Creates section 381.06016, Florida Statutes, requiring the Department of Health to post resources and website links from the Parent's Guide to Cord Blood Foundation on its website regarding umbilical cord blood banking.

  • Department of Health must provide information on the potential uses of cord blood, differences between public and private banking, available options for stem cell storage or donation, collection processes, and costs.

  • Department of Health shall encourage health care providers to make umbilical cord blood banking information available to pregnant patients before the third trimester or at the first prenatal visit.

  • Health care providers and facilities are protected from civil liability, criminal prosecution, and disciplinary action by regulatory boards when acting in good faith to comply with the law's requirements.

  • Effective date: July 1, 2011.
